Since I can't find a thread dedicated to AMEX gold I guess I will ask here. What is the real difference between the various flavors of the gold cards, i.e., Rewards, Rewards Plus and Preferred Rewards. I read the advertisement on the AMEX website and they all seem to have the same earning and redeeming ratios, etc. Maybe someone who have/had the different gold cards can comment on this?

Rewards vs Preferred Rewards is the Membership Options difference. Major difference is if you use your points for frequent flier miles with the Rewards card 1 mile = 2 points, if you have a Preferred Rewards card 1 mile = 1 point.
Rewards Plus is $150 for up to I think 6 cards. This is good if you need more than 2 cards since with Rewards and Preferred Rewards you pay $90 for the first card and $35 for each additional. With Rewards Plus it's $150 for up to 6 cards. They also give you bonuses for your first year (Rewards Plus).
In general, my take is this: If you want 1:1 ratio for frequent flier miles and don't mind paying a little more go with Preferred Rewards. If you need more than 2 cards go with Rewards Plus.
But, off the top of my head these are the major differences!
Hope this helps.
